Exports In 2023, Nigeria exported $200M in Refined Copper, making it the 41st largest exporter of Refined Copper in the world. At the same year, Refined Copper was the 13th most exported product in Nigeria. The main destination of Refined Copper exports from Nigeria are: China ($86.5M), Japan ($82.1M), South Korea ($21.6M), Thailand ($2.84M), and India ($1.96M).

The fastest growing export markets for Refined Copper of Nigeria between 2022 and 2023 were Japan ($41.3M), China ($25.1M), and Thailand ($2.84M).

Imports In 2023, Nigeria imported $1.08M in Refined Copper, becoming the 85th largest importer of Refined Copper in the world. At the same year, Refined Copper was the 798th most imported product in Nigeria. Nigeria imports Refined Copper primarily from: Italy ($403k), India ($314k), United Kingdom ($250k), France ($102k), and Japan ($4.04k).

The fastest growing import markets in Refined Copper for Nigeria between 2022 and 2023 were United Kingdom ($250k), Italy ($244k), and Japan ($4.04k).
